[v2,4/5] powerpc: Fix duplicate const clang warning in user access code

From: Anton Blanchard <anton@samba.org>

This re-applies b91c1e3e7a6f which was reverted in f2ca80905929
d466f6c5cac1 f84ed59a612d (powerpc/sparse: Constify the address pointer
...").

We see a large number of duplicate const errors in the user access
code when building with llvm/clang:

  include/linux/pagemap.h:576:8: warning: duplicate 'const' declaration specifier
      [-Wduplicate-decl-specifier]
        ret = __get_user(c, uaddr);

The problem is we are doing const __typeof__(*(ptr)), which will hit the
warning if ptr is marked const.

Removing const does not seem to have any effect on GCC code generation.

Signed-off-by: Anton Blanchard <anton@samba.org>
Signed-off-by: Joel Stanley <joel@jms.id.au>
---
If we don't want to apply this, other options are suppressing the
warning, or wait for a fix to land in clang
(https://github.com/ClangBuiltLinux/linux/issues/52).

diff --git a/arch/powerpc/include/asm/uaccess.h b/arch/powerpc/include/asm/uaccess.h
index bac225bb7f64..15bea9a0f260 100644
--- a/arch/powerpc/include/asm/uaccess.h
+++ b/arch/powerpc/include/asm/uaccess.h
@@ -260,7 +260,7 @@  do {								\
 ({								\
 	long __gu_err;						\
 	__long_type(*(ptr)) __gu_val;				\
-	const __typeof__(*(ptr)) __user *__gu_addr = (ptr);	\
+	__typeof__(*(ptr)) __user *__gu_addr = (ptr);	\
 	__chk_user_ptr(ptr);					\
 	if (!is_kernel_addr((unsigned long)__gu_addr))		\
 		might_fault();					\
@@ -274,7 +274,7 @@  do {								\
 ({									\
 	long __gu_err = -EFAULT;					\
 	__long_type(*(ptr)) __gu_val = 0;				\
-	const __typeof__(*(ptr)) __user *__gu_addr = (ptr);		\
+	__typeof__(*(ptr)) __user *__gu_addr = (ptr);		\
 	might_fault();							\
 	if (access_ok(VERIFY_READ, __gu_addr, (size))) {		\
 		barrier_nospec();					\
@@ -288,7 +288,7 @@  do {								\
 ({								\
 	long __gu_err;						\
 	__long_type(*(ptr)) __gu_val;				\
-	const __typeof__(*(ptr)) __user *__gu_addr = (ptr);	\
+	__typeof__(*(ptr)) __user *__gu_addr = (ptr);	\
 	__chk_user_ptr(ptr);					\
 	barrier_nospec();					\
 	__get_user_size(__gu_val, __gu_addr, (size), __gu_err);	\
